How to Replace a Battery

When your Toyota key fob isn't responding as fast in responding to clicks on the buttons, it's time to replace the battery. It's a simple task to do and you can complete it at the convenience of your own home. The team of service at Berge Toyota Chandler can help you with this task or help you learn how to complete it!

To change the battery on a toyota h key keyfob, open the case. Put a flathead screwdriver, or coin into the slot or notch between the two sides of your fob. Continue to press and twist the edges until the fob snaps.

The circuit board will be visible, and an empty battery. You'll have to buy the right battery if you aren't sure what kind it uses. These batteries are often available at your local electronic store or online. Test the battery after having installed it. If it still isn't working, reopen the fob, and adjust the battery until the connections are toyota key fobs waterproof clean and making contact.

Reseal the fob after replacing the battery. You may have to relocate the circuit board so that it's covering the battery when you close the fob.

The battery is the most common reason for the Toyota keyfob not functioning. You can replace the battery at home if the battery is dying or dead. The process is simple and requires only a few basic tools. First, open the case with the built-in key (newer models), or a thin object at the slot or notch that is designated. Once the case has been opened, lift the circuit board up to reveal the battery.

The CR2032 is the most common battery that is used in Toyotas. You can easily find it online or at our parts store near San Jose. Once you have the correct battery, gently lift it up from the case and insert it in the same position that the old battery was placed. Insert the new battery and place the case back into it's place.

After replacing your Toyota key fob battery, you can shut the case and try it out to make sure it works. If your key fob will not function, you can either re-adjust the battery or go to a Toyota service centre to request an alternative. How do you replace a key?

Sometimes, whether you're on your commute to work or running on errands during the weekend, your key fob will stop working. Luckily, it's usually just an issue with the battery or an easy solution.

If your key fob appears sluggish and you're not able to lock or unlock your vehicle, it's time for a new key fob battery. The replacement is available in a majority of electronic stores or even online. Before you open the case, you should ensure whether your key fob is compatible with the new battery. Most Toyota models require the CR2032 battery, however, you should check with your owner's manual to be sure.

Once you've gotten your new battery, open the key that is hidden inside or use a tiny tool to press a notch to open the case. There will be a small green battery and a circuit board. Take the circuit board off carefully to expose the battery. Take note of the position of the battery in the case and then order the appropriate replacement.

After putting in the new battery, place the circuit board back in place and snap the case shut. If your key fob won't work after you test it, replace the battery. You can also reach out to an expert from Mossy Toyota to have a key fob programmed or a complete replacement.
